The Phoenix: Chapter of Dawn / Hi no tori - Reimei hen (movie)
Running time: 138 minutes
Vintage: 1978-08-19Plot Summary: “All things are born and all things die. That is the law of heaven.” According to legend, the Bird of Fire called the Phoenix is the eternal spirit of life, death and rebirth. She oversees the cycle of reincarnation and the rising and falling of civilizations and species. Those who can obtain her blood will be granted eternal life, while to others she can grant infinite wisdom, or eternal suffering. Throughout history, from the dawn of civilization to the extinction of the human race, those human souls touched by the Phoenix have hunted her over and over in multiple reincarnations, and their actions in one life determine or reflect the sins and sufferings of other lifetimes. The Phoenix: Chapter of Ho-o / Phoenix: Karma Chapter / Hi no Tori: Ho-o-hen (movie)
Themes: tragedy
Objectionable content: Significant
Running time: 60 minutes
Vintage: 1986
Premiere date: 1986-12-20 (Japan)
Ending Theme: “Hi no Tori (Phoenix)” by Noriko WatanabePlot Summary: This is an animation version of the most popular masterpieces of the Phoenix series. The characters are pictured quite differently from the way they are in the original Manga, and several arguments occurred over the production of this animated cartoon itself. However, the high quality direction by Rintaro added stability to the work. The story is about two characters, Akanemaru, a sculpture genius, and ex-burglar Gao whose only purpose in life is sculpting, and how they struggle with the fate to compete with each other over their capacity and talent. Phoenix / Hinotori (2004)
Genres: adventure, drama, science fiction, supernatural
Themes: historical
Running time: 25 minutes per episode
Number of episodes: 13
Vintage: 2004-03-21 to 2004-06-27
Opening Theme: “‘Hi no Tori’ Opening Theme” by Min Chen, Mio Isayama and the Czech Philharmonic Orchestra
Ending Theme: “Hi no Tori” by Mika NakashimaPlot Summary: Hi no Tori is a collection of stories that all have something in common. The Phoenix, whose blood is believed to give an eternal life to one who drinks it. Therefore many seek to kill it, but as the Phoenix of the tale, it’s reborn from the ashes. Stories take place in future and the past, where humans fight with each other as always, and everyone is afraid to die. But still, every story teaches a lesson: Life is beginning of an eternity, an never-ending cycle. (from ANN)
